Orbit wins Dustin March Madness 2015

In this year's Dustin March Madness Team Orbit managed to beat up Team Property with 2-0 and to claim a $7,000 grand prize.

Dustin March Madness is a two team LAN tournament that has been held in Sweden for the last fifteen years, at the Ericsson Globe during the Dustin Expo, a trade fair for IT and consumer electronics. This year's edition featured Team Orbit and Team Property fighting for the $10,000 in best-of-three match.

The first map which was de_cache started off well for Orbit as they had 10-5 lead on CT side and a nice amount of rounds to work with as they were moving to less favored T side. Property was expecting to get this map back into their hands, as they are well known for a very well CT side. However, led by the phenomenal SKYTTEN, Orbit didn't struggle much to close this map with 16-8 and to move over to de_inferno.

On de_inferno we could see Orbit continuing with the same level of performance from the first map, as they were easily breaking Property's defense on this map. In the end they finished the first half with a 9-6 lead on their CT side. The next half had Property man up and manage to strike back in the second half, but with rounds going back and forth it wasn't enough to take this map away from Orbit. The final score of de_inferno was 16-13 for Orbit.

Dustin March Madness 2015 standings:
1. Team Orbit - $7,000
2. Team Property - $3,000
